

El vuelo (Flight)
Directed by Robert ZemeckisTras un aterrizaje de emergencia en medio del campo gracias al cual salvan la vida un centenar de pasajeros, el comandante Whip Whitaker (Denzel Washington), que pilotaba el avión, es considerado un héroe nacional. Sin embargo, cuando se pone en marcha la investigación para determinar las causas de la avería, se averigua que el capitán tenía exceso de alcohol en la sangre.

- flavo4322 de noviembre de 2025Flight is a gripping character study built around one haunting question: is Captain Whip Whitaker a hero or a villain? Denzel Washington has played many leads with deep, complex flaws, but none quite as torn apart as Whip. He saves almost everyone on board with an impossible crash landing, yet he’s also drunk, high, and lying to himself and everyone else. The film refuses to let you sit comfortably on either side of that moral line. Washington carries all of Whip’s guilt, charm, denial, and raw fear in every scene, making his slow unraveling difficult to watch but impossible to look away from. The spectacular, terrifying plane sequence hooks you early, but it’s the aftermath—the investigations, relationships, and self-destruction—that truly defines the movie. Flight becomes less a disaster film and more a story about addiction, truth, and the painful cost of finally owning who you really are.

El vuelo (Flight) Trivia
El vuelo (Flight) was released on 2 de noviembre de 2012.
El vuelo (Flight) was directed by Robert Zemeckis.
El vuelo (Flight) has a runtime of 2h 18min.
El vuelo (Flight) was produced by Laurie MacDonald, Walter F. Parkes, Jack Rapke, Steve Starkey, Robert Zemeckis.
The key characters in El vuelo (Flight) are Whip Whitaker (Denzel Washington), Hugh Lang (Don Cheadle), Nicole (Kelly Reilly).
El vuelo (Flight) is rated 16.
El vuelo (Flight) is a Drama, Suspense film.
